What is Prevagen?

Prevagen is a dietary supplement developed by Quincy Bioscience, and it contains a unique ingredient known as apoaequorin, a protein derived from jellyfish. The product is marketed primarily for its potential benefits in enhancing memory and cognitive function, especially in older adults. Unlike traditional nootropics, which often contain stimulants or synthetic compounds, Prevagen’s formulation is touted as a more natural alternative.

The Science Behind Prevagen

Prevagen’s primary active ingredient, apoaequorin, is claimed to support brain health by regulating calcium levels in brain cells, thereby protecting them from damage. The underlying theory is that calcium imbalance can lead to cognitive decline, and by restoring this balance, memory function can be improved. However, the scientific evidence supporting these claims is mixed.

A clinical trial published in 2016 in the journal “Alzheimer’s & Dementia” reported that Prevagen improved cognitive function in some participants. However, this study has faced scrutiny regarding its methodology, including the small sample size and the lack of a placebo-controlled group. Critics argue that more extensive, rigorous studies are necessary to validate the claims made by Prevagen.

Prevagen Reviews: User Experiences

When examining Prevagen reviews, the experiences of users vary widely. Many individuals report positive outcomes, claiming improvements in memory, focus, and overall cognitive function. Users often cite enhanced mental clarity and a greater ability to recall information, which can be particularly appealing for older adults concerned about age-related cognitive decline.

However, not all Prevagen reviews are favorable. Some users have reported little to no change in their cognitive abilities after using the supplement. Additionally, some reviewers express concerns about the high cost of Prevagen relative to its effectiveness. With a monthly supply costing around $60, many users expect significant results for their investment.

Safety and Side Effects

Prevagen is generally considered safe when taken as directed, with most users experiencing minimal side effects. However, some individuals have reported mild side effects such as headaches, dizziness, and gastrointestinal discomfort. As with any supplement, it’s advisable for potential users to consult with a healthcare professional before starting Prevagen, especially if they have pre-existing health conditions or are taking other medications.
